Sila has secured a significant $1.4 billion loan from the U.S. Department of Defense to enhance its battery production capabilities in Washington State. This funding is crucial as military demand for advanced batteries continues to grow, particularly for electric and hybrid vehicles.

Introduction

In a significant move for the battery technology sector, Sila, a materials startup focused on revolutionizing battery production, has announced a monumental $1.4 billion loan from the U.S. Department of Defense. This funding is set to be utilized for scaling up Sila’s manufacturing operations in Washington State. The Growing Demand for Advanced Batteries

Recent reports indicate a surge in demand for high-performance batteries, which are critical for electric vehicles, drones, and various military applications. The Pentagon’s investment in Sila reflects a strategic effort to secure supply chains for these essential technologies. Here are a few key reasons why this funding is critical:

  • Military operations increasingly rely on electric and hybrid vehicles.
  • Advanced batteries are essential for next-gen weapon systems.
  • Demand from the commercial sector for sustainable energy solutions continues to grow.
  • Investment in domestic battery production reduces reliance on foreign sources.
